  • Patent number: 8323551
    Abstract: Provided in this invention are polyethylene terephthalate resins which can suppress the formation of acetaldehyde as a by-product in melt molding of the resins and can provide the molded products reduced in acetaldehyde content. A polyethylene terephthalate resin which has an intrinsic viscosity [?2] of not less than 0.70 dl/g and not more than 1.50 dl/g and an acetaldehyde content [AA0 (ppm by weight)] of not more than 10 ppm by weight, and has such properties that the acetaldehyde content [AA1 (ppm by weight)] of the molded product obtained by injection molding the resin at 280° C. with its moisture content adjusted to 30±20 ppm by weight and the acetaldehyde content [AA2 (ppm by weight)] of the molded product obtained by injection molding the resin at 280° C. with its moisture content adjusted to 120±20 ppm by weight satisfy the following formula (1): [(AA1?AA2)/AA1]×100?30??(1).

  • Patent number: 5153302
    Abstract: A biaxially oriented polyester film for use in a capacitor having improved break down strength, which polyester having an acid component at least 90% by mole of which is terephthalic acid and a glycol component at least 97% by mole of which is 1,4-cyclohexanedimenthanol, in which film, an extracted amount with chloroform is not more than 1.3% by weight per 24 hours.
